As a professional you will be required learn your art of asking pertinent questions . But most importantly, you need to know how to effectively respond to questions.

Before you get started on answering your question, ensure you're in a state of mind about what the question is about. There is no harm in getting clarity on what's being asked. If you are asked politely "I apologize, I'm not sure if I understand what you are asking Do you mind rephrasing?" You will communicate better by doing this rather than talking in a rambling manner with no sense of clarity and understanding. Remember that the essence of answering questions is in a positive way to the one who is in search of an answer. Don't waste time. Seek understanding first.

One strategy to increase the effectiveness of answering a question in a relevant and objective manner is if you give the person who is asking questions time to complete asking. A few people take time to clearly define what they are seeking. In answering a question prior to it is properly asked might seem to be disrespectful. Don't assume you know the direction the questions are taking and therefore should assist the person to get to the point. If you're not pressed for time then let the individual "ramble" while you make note of the key elements. It gives you the time to make sense of and consider the most effective answer to the question. The ability to hear gives you a high success rate in answering the questions.

You have to establish if you're competent to answer the query or if somebody else is. Does your license permit you to speak regarding this issue (journalists could be a source of trouble even though you're not expected to be the company's spokesperson)? How deep should the answer be? A few moments of silence will show that you're just churning up any material you have in your mind but a clearly reasoned out answer is on its way. It is possible to prepare someone for to answer you by asking "Let me think ..., Let me know." ..". This will help the person not sit and wait thinking they haven't heard the answer, and instead you're simply ignoring your own thoughts. Being able to think through the issue helps to come up with statements which you'll not regret about later. It is possible to identify the best solution to make your point without leaving bruises or fresh wounds.
